DATED : OCTOBER 06, 2022 Heard Shri Wahane, learned Counsel for the petitioners, and Shri Mirza, learned Counsel for the respondent no.3.
2) It appears that there is a dispute as to the facts of the case in between petitioners on one hand and the respondent no.3 on the other. While it is the contention of Shri Mirza, learned Counsel for the respondent no.3, that Yavatmal Police is providing security to the petitioners on the dates of hearing of whistle blowers' matters before the Courts, it is the contention of the Shri Wahane, learned Counsel for the petitioners, that this is not so.
0610cp248.21 2/2 3) In fact, in a case like this, it would be appropriate that the petitioners and the respondent no.3 sit together and sort out the matter in between themselves. Ultimately, there is a decision already taken by the concerned Committee to provide selective security to the petitioners and, therefore, it is for the respondent no.3 to implement the decision of the concerned Committee in its letter and spirit. For this purpose, the respondent no.3 may call for necessary details from the petitioners as well as his own Department, verify the facts of the case and then take a proper decision in the matter.
4) With the above observations, we dispose of the contempt petition.
